21st Century Scientific's Sliding Back Power Recline System (SBPRS) can be installed on all BOUNDER models with weight capacities up to 600 lb. With SBPRS, the back slides downward as it reclines. This reduces the "shear" or pull on the user's clothing and skin. The result is a more comfortable reclining motion that reduces the necessity of repositioning. The ball bearing slide mechanism is configured for up to 3.5" of movement between the sliding back and the back frame.
21st Century Scientific's Power Recline System (PRS) can be installed on all BOUNDER models with weight capacities up to 1000 lb. With a power recliner, a user can adjust the back recline angle from nearly vertical to nearly horizontal, up to 80 degrees of recline depending on user weight. The PRS gives the owner added independence and improved seating comfort.
Toggle switch control or optional Through-The-Joystick control of the power recline is available. Can be combined with a Power Center Mount Footboard or Dual Independent Power Elevating Legrests (DIPLR).
HEADREST - PTS does not include a headrest. Since most users do require a headrest, be sure to order one if you need it. Many styles are available; adjustable center post headrests are the most popular.
JOYSTICK PSS CTRL - Joystick Control of Power Seating System. Allows user to control up to six different actuators through the joystick. Speed and direction of movement are controlled by joystick position. Control is very smooth and actuator jerking is eliminated.
PSS XHD - Power Seating System Xtra Heavy Duty Upgrade (for users above 400 lbs). Usually the amount of tilt is limited to 30 degrees.
